2 probable etymologies.

It always surprises me how these everyday words we use in English are actually opaque in etymology.

I mean, we say "throw up", but do we ever really think that it means to throw something in your belly up and out onto the floor or the street or into the toilet or wherever?

Likewise, a "saucer" probably once meant something that held sauce, but do we ever think of that?
